Marilyn Gambles Child “Muth”

It is with heavy hearts that we announce the passing of our beloved mother, wife, grandma, and friend, Marilyn, who returned to her Heavenly Father on November 11, 2017 at the age of 79. She passed away from complications associated with Alzheimer’s disease.

Marilyn was born on August 2, 1938, in Pocatello, Idaho to George Roscoe and Thelma Brim Gambles.  She was the youngest of eight children.  She enjoyed an idyllic childhood growing up on a farm in Swan Lake, Idaho. At 15, her beloved mother passed away.

Marilyn graduated from Marsh Valley High School in 1956 and shortly thereafter moved to the Salt Lake City, Utah area. She was married to Richard Lyman DeMille in 1958 and two boys were born to her, Richard and Mark.

On March 1, 1969, Marilyn married the love of her life, Lawrence R. Child. Their marriage was later solemnized in the Salt Lake Temple.  Three more children were subsequently born to her: Kim, Teresa, and Karen. Together they raised their five children in Layton, Utah.

Marilyn cherished her close, frequent association with her siblings and their children.  She adored and loved her grandchildren. Each moment she spent with them brought her tremendous joy and satisfaction.

Marilyn was a member of the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ints where she served faithfully in many callings over her lifetime including Primary president, Relief Society president, and Sunday school organist.

She loved being a full-time homemaker and raising her children. In 1987, she began working for the Lakeside Review, a subsidiary of the Ogden Standard-Examiner. She continued working there until she retired in 2001.

Marilyn was a skilled seamstress and excellent cook.  She was a die-hard BYU fan and a devoted Utah Jazz fan. She relished the time she spent ballroom dancing with her sweetheart, Ross.

She is survived by her husband Lawrence “Ross” Child, her children Richard, Mark (Cindy) Child, Kim (Tricia) Child, Teresa (Eric) Johnsen, Karen (Shane) Robinson, sixteen grandchildren, and two great grandchildren, her siblings Barbara Luke, Lois Hess, Harry Gambles, Milton Gambles and Kay Young. She was preceded in death by her parents, three brothers, Paul, Phil, and Theron Gambles and her stepmother Ruby Gambles.
